Diesel fuel made in the island from old chip oil is now on sale. It is being produced by Channel Island Biodiesel Products Ltd, in St Mary, and will cost around 70p per litre.

The company collects waste cooking oil from restaurants and take-aways and converts it into fuel.

Steve Harrison, who runs the company, said he could convert around five tons of fuel a week. Before his operation was up and running, the oil was shipped to the UK for disposal.

The locally-produced biodiesel will be used to fuel vehicles of the States of Jersey
